Can anyone tell me if the car (while chipped) can be run on normal unleaded or will it need the expensive stuff ??
Thanks
Kevin
-
Yes it can, but to be honest you are better spending the extra on good quality fuel, V-Power or BP Ultimate, Tesco 99 etc. It will be better for your car in the long run and the higher octane will give better power results with the remap.
It will only work out at £2.50-£3.00 extra per tank over standard unleaded.
